Light can be considered as a small packet of energy (a quantum) called a "photon" carried along a wave or ripple in space-time, rather like a beach ball carried along in the trough of a wave across a body of water. A more detailed explanation requires an understanding of quantum mechanics.

The unit for measuring the rate at which light energy is radiated from a source is the lumen. The lumen is symbolized as lm.
The lumen is the unit used to measure the rate at which light energy is radiated from a source. The lumen represents the international standard unit of luminous flux that is based on the candela.

Light is radiated from the Sun, the Moon and the Earth. Radiation is a "shining out" from whatever is making the light. When we see the Moon we are seeing it because the Sun has radiated light out into space and some of it has lit up the Moon, which then reflects the moonlight to Earth. The electricity runs through a coil of Tungsten. Tungsten has a very high resistance. As per Joule's Law, energy radiated is directly proportional to resistance. The energy radiated is so large that the coil starts to glow and light is produced.
